Prep and Cook Time
- Readiness: 15 minutes
- Cooking: 40 minutes
- total Time: 55 minutes
Yield
Serves 4 generous portions
Difficulty Level
Easy – perfect for beginner to intermediate home cooks
Ingredients
- 1 medium spaghetti squash (about 3 pounds),halved and seeded
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 4 cloves garlic,finely minced
- 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- 1/2 cup heavy cream or half-and-half for a lighter option
- 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
- Salt and freshly cracked black pepper,to taste
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ley,chopped,for garnish
- Red pepper flakes (optional,for a hint of heat)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Prepare the spaghetti squash by cutting it lengthwise with a sharp knife. Carefully scoop out the seeds and the stringy pulp with a spoon. Drizzle the cut sides with 1 tablespoon of olive oil and sprinkle with salt.
- Place the squash cut-side down on the baking sheet and roast for 35-40 minutes,or until the flesh is tender and easily pierced with a fork. Let it cool slightly before handling.
- Using a fork, gently shred the squash flesh into spaghetti-like strands and transfer them to a large mixing bowl.
- In a medium sk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until fragrant and lightly golden, about 2-3 minutes.be careful not to burn the garlic.
- Stir in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er. Reduce heat to low,than add the Parmesan cheese gradually while stirring until it melts into a creamy sauce.
- Season the sauce with salt, freshly cracked black pepper, and red pepper flakes if using. Adjust to taste.
- Pour the garlic Parmesan sauce over the spaghetti squash strands and toss gently to combine.Drizzle the remaining tablespoon of olive oil for extra silkiness and sheen.
- Transfer to serving bowls and garnish with chopped fresh parsley. Serve immediately for the best texture and flavor.
Choosing the Perfect Spaghetti Squash for Maximum Flavor
When selecting your spaghetti squash, look for one that feels heavy for its size with a firm, matte skin. The vibrant golden-yellow hue signals ripeness and sweetness. Avoid any with soft spots or blemishes,which indicate overripeness or damage. Smaller squash varieties often have more tender flesh,perfect for delicate strands that soak up the garlic Parmesan sauce effortlessly. If possible,pick up your squash from a local farmer’s market for an even fresher,more flavorful experience.
Mastering the Garlic Parmesan Sauce for Irresistible Taste
The secret to the signature garlic Parmesan sauce lies in balancing richness with fresh aromatics. Start with high-quality butter and real Parmesan cheese-not pre-grated powders-to create a luscious, silky texture. Mince your garlic finely and sauté gently; this unlocks deep flavor without bitterness. Adding cream softens the sharpness of the Parmesan, while a splash of olive oil at the end gives a smooth finish. Feel free to customize with a pinch of nutmeg or a dash of white pepper to elevate complexity subtly.

Tips for Storing and Reheating to Maintain Freshness and Texture
To keep your spaghetti squash with garlic Parmesan tasting fresh, store it covered in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in a skillet over low heat, stirring occasionally to maintain the silky sauce without drying out the squash strands. Avoid the microwave for reheating as it can alter the texture. If needed, add a splash of cream or olive oil during reheating to refresh the sauce’s creaminess. For longer storage, freeze in portion-sized containers; thaw overnight in the fridge and reheat using the skillet method for best results.

Q3: What’s the best way to cook spaghetti squash to get that perfect spaghetti-like texture?
A3: Roasting is the golden ticket! Slice the squash in half, scoop out the seeds, drizzle with olive oil, and roast cut-side down at 400°F (200°C) for about 40 minutes. This caramelizes the edges and makes those strands beautifully tender yet firm enough to mimic pasta’s “bite.”
Q4: Can spaghetti squash with garlic Parmesan be made vegan or dairy-free?
A4: absolutely! Swap Parmesan for nutritional yeast or a plant-based cheese alternative for that cheesy tang without dairy. Use olive oil or vegan butter to sauté the garlic, and you’ve got a hearty, flavorful dish everyone can enjoy.
